3. Key Components of Anti-Rust Oils


The efficacy of anti-rust oils lies in their formulation. A well-structured anti-rust oil contains several key components, each contributing to its overall performance and protective capabilities.

3.1 Base Oils: The Foundation of Anti-Rust Oils


Base oils are the primary constituents of anti-rust products. They are typically derived from mineral or synthetic sources. Mineral oils are refined from crude oil, while synthetic oils are engineered to provide superior performance characteristics. The choice of base oil can affect the viscosity, volatility, and overall performance of the anti-rust oil.

3.2 Additives: Enhancing Performance and Stability


To improve the performance of anti-rust oils, various additives are incorporated into the formulation. These can include:
- **Dispersants**: Help to suspend particles and prevent sludge formation.
- **Emulsifiers**: Allow the oil to mix with water, enhancing corrosion protection in humid environments.
- **Antioxidants**: Prevent oxidation of the oil, prolonging its effective life.
Each additive serves a specific purpose, enhancing the oil's stability and effectiveness as a corrosion inhibitor.

3.3 Corrosion Inhibitors: Protecting Metal Surfaces


Corrosion inhibitors are vital in anti-rust oils. These compounds work by forming a protective layer on metal surfaces, blocking moisture and oxygen. Common types of corrosion inhibitors include:
- **Film-forming inhibitors**: Create a physical barrier.
- **Volatile corrosion inhibitors (VCIs)**: Release vapors that settle on the metal surface, providing protection even in enclosed spaces.
Selecting the appropriate corrosion inhibitors is crucial for optimizing the protective capabilities of anti-rust oils.

4. How Anti-Rust Oils Work


Anti-rust oils function through a multi-faceted approach to corrosion prevention. When applied to metal surfaces, they create a hydrophobic barrier that repels moisture. This barrier inhibits the electrochemical reactions that typically lead to rust formation. Moreover, the presence of corrosion inhibitors further enhances the protective layer, ensuring long-term efficacy even in challenging environments.

5. Different Types of Anti-Rust Oils


There are various types of anti-rust oils available in the market, each tailored for specific applications:
- **Temporary Anti-Rust Oils**: Designed for short-term protection during shipping or storage.
- **Long-Term Anti-Rust Oils**: Provide extended protection for machinery and equipment.
- **Water-Displacing Oils**: Form a thin film that displaces moisture, ideal for humid conditions.
Understanding these distinctions helps users select the most appropriate product for their needs.

7. Selecting the Right Anti-Rust Oil for Your Needs


Choosing the proper anti-rust oil requires consideration of several factors:
- **Type of Metal**: Different metals may require specific types of protection.
- **Environmental Conditions**: Consider humidity, temperature, and exposure to corrosive substances.
- **Application Method**: Whether spray, dip, or brush application may impact product choice.
By evaluating these factors, users can optimize their anti-rust oil selection for maximum effectiveness.

8. Frequently Asked Questions (FAQs)



  • What is anti-rust oil?
    Anti-rust oil is a protective lubricant designed to prevent corrosion and rusting of metal surfaces.

  • How do I apply anti-rust oil?
    Application methods vary; anti-rust oils can be sprayed, dipped, or brushed onto the metal surfaces, depending on the product.

  • Can I use anti-rust oil on all types of metals?
    While anti-rust oils are effective on many metals, always check the product specifications to ensure compatibility.

  • How long does anti-rust oil last?
    The longevity of anti-rust oil effectiveness depends on environmental conditions and the specific product, with some offering protection for months or even years.

  • Can I remove anti-rust oil once applied?
    Yes, you can clean off anti-rust oil using solvents or degreasers, but this should be done before any surface treatment or painting.
